有以下程序 #inculde #deFine SUB(a) (a) (a) main() { int a=2,B=3,c=5,d; d=SUB(a+B)*c; printF(”%d\n”,d); } 程序运行后的输山结果是

admin2013-02-23  28

问题 有以下程序
#inculde
#deFine SUB(a) (a) (a)
main()
{  int a=2,B=3,c=5,d;
   d=SUB(a+B)*c;
   printF(”%d\n”,d);
}
程序运行后的输山结果是

选项 A、0
B、-12
C、-20
D、10

答案C

解析 在此处需要直接替换整个式子,SUB(a+b)*c即为(a+b)-(a+b)*c,代入a,b,c的值可得结果为-20。
转载请注明原文地址:https://kaotiyun.com/show/wlPp777K
0

最新回复(0)